使用 Arduino 和 MATLAB 进行实时数据采集
使用 LabVIEW(LINX 和 LIFA)、MATLAB 对 Arduino 进行编程。
讲师:Salim Khan
双语IT资源独家Udemy付费课程,独家中英文字幕,配套资料齐全!
用不到1/10的价格,即可享受同样的高品质课程,且可以完全拥有,随时随地都可以任意观看和分享。
您将学到什么
- 了解 Arduino UNO 是什么
- 了解模拟和数字输入和输出
- 编写可获取传感器读数的简单 Arduino 程序
- 了解什么是 Arduino 编程、其基本概念、结构和关键字
- 为自己的项目设计电路并编写代码
探索相关主题
- Arduino
- 工程
- 教学与学术
要求
- 能够使用计算机(课程涵盖 Windows 和 Mac,Arduino 也可在 Linux 上运行)
- Arduino Uno
描述
Arduino 是一个开源计算机硬件/软件平台,用于构建能够感知和控制周围物理世界的数字设备和交互式对象。在本课程中,您将了解 Arduino 平台在物理板、库和 IDE(集成开发环境)方面的工作原理。
完成本课程后,您将能够:
1.概述Arduino开发板的组成
2. 描述编程板固件的含义
3. 阅读电路板原理图
4.安装Arduino IDE
5.采集数字/模拟/PWM信号
6. 生成数字/模拟/PWM信号
7. 上拉寄存器/下拉寄存器
8. 触摸传感器接口
9、采集数字信号并产生数字信号。
10.使用 LabVIEW 进行 Arduino 编程。
11. 使用 MATLAB 进行 Arduino 编程。
用于原型设计、播放和制作的多功能工具
Arduino 既是硬件平台,也是编程语言。通过学习如何构建电路和代码,您可以为项目增加新的交互性,制作潜在产品的原型,并获得新技能(同时希望玩得开心)。
Arduino 编程语言基于 C 和 C++ 的组合。了解这些编码基础知识后,您将能够更轻松地学习新语言,例如 Java、Python、JavaScript、C# 和 Swift,这些语言在就业市场上需求量很大。
Arduino 通过接收来自传感器等附加设备的输入来感知环境,并可以通过调节灯光、电机和其他执行器来控制周围的世界。在本课程中,您将学习如何以及何时使用不同类型的传感器以及如何将它们连接到 Arduino。由于外部世界使用连续或模拟信号,而硬件是数字的,您将了解这些信号是如何来回转换的,以及在对设备进行编程时必须如何考虑这一点。您还将了解如何使用 Arduino 特定的屏蔽罩和屏蔽罩软件库与现实世界交互。请注意,本课程不包括讨论论坛。
本课程适合哪些人:
- 有兴趣在项目中添加电子产品和互动功能的创客、工匠和学生
显示更多显示较少
如果你有能力,请务必支持课程的原创作者,这是他们应得的报酬!
本站收取的费用,仅用来维持网站正常运行的必要支出,从本站下载任何内容,说明你已经知晓并同意此条款。